Abstract
The work of calculating the convergence and energy dissipation of upstream and downstream water through the sluice is heavy, whereas the VB language programming which has the advantage of computer technology can solve this problem. This program can solve the water calculation of the plane gates that is flat bottom with wide top weir, including drawing the relation curve of downstream water level and water flow, and calculating the design of energy dissipation and erosion control. Especially the size of stilling basin that is calculated with pilot calculation will receive better effect with this program.
